python 3.6.4安装cx_freeze(cxfreeze)成功过程分享

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了python 3.6.4安装cx_freeze(cxfreeze)成功过程分享相关的知识,希望对你有一定的参考价值。

环境:
win7
python 3.6.4
cx_freeze版本xxx

技术分享图片
本来就是想安装个python 3可以打包exe,一直安装cx_freeze失败,综合了几个文章。总算做出来了。

总体分析一下:
我没有去官网下载安装文件,因为下载安装失败了。所以后来都卸载了。
技术分享图片
技术分享图片
最后做的步骤是:
1 打开cmd 输入pip install cx_freeze (如果有问题就到python安装目录下的script文件中),目前的版本默认安装了pip。
技术分享图片

2 输入python cxfreeze-postinstall

试试cx_freeze -h 应该是失败的。
不过 cxfreeze -h或许能成功了。
我参考他的。
https://blog.csdn.net/candcplusplus/article/details/46964783

3 接下来步骤参考他的:https://www.cnblogs.com/hades/articles/8960786.html
我就重新执行了 pip install cxfreeze
python cxfreeze-postinstall
还是有异常
不过这次能看到问题在于cxfreeze.bat
内容:
@echo off
C:Program Files (x86)Python36-32python.exe C:Program Files (x86)Python36-32Scriptscxfreeze %*
应该是因为空格,所以我加了双引号。如下,两个路径

@echo off
"C:Program Files (x86)Python36-32python.exe" "C:Program Files (x86)Python36-32Scriptscxfreeze" %*
技术分享图片

技术分享图片
执行成功!

以上是关于python 3.6.4安装cx_freeze(cxfreeze)成功过程分享的主要内容,如果未能解决你的问题,请参考以下文章

如何在 cx_freeze 和 distutils 中指定 msi 的默认安装路径?

使用 Python 的 cx_Freeze 安装程序添加开始菜单快捷方式

Python 3 + pyQt5 + cx_freeze

win7Python3.4安装cx_freeze

python3怎么打包成exe

pyodbc python 3.4的cx_freeze错误